Comp6209 System Analysis And Assessment Answer
Tasks
The general intention is to design the required system through system analysis and design techniques using UML modelling.
Use the given case study to write a Business Requirements Statement for the new system. Use the Unified Modelling Language (UML) to achieve the modelling.
Task1: General report structure
a. Cover page and Table of Contents
b. Report structure / neatness (introductions, professional presentation, report structure apply sections, referencing, font … etc.)
Task 2: Business requirement identification
Document all the requirements for the system by studying the scenario and make required assumptions.
a. List all identified functional requirements in a table / Matrix (Templates available)
b. List all identified non-functional requirements ( including assumed ones) in a table /Matrix (Templates available)
Task 3: Activity Diagram for whole assumed system (full system process modelling)
Produce an activity diagram for the whole required system including swim-lanes, objects and actors involved in the system operations. This activity diagram is being used as a process modelling to understand the whole operational processes within car parking system.
Task 4: Actor Glossary / UseCase Glossary
a. Actor Glossary ( a List of actors[roles] related to the system )/Table ( templates to be used)
b. Use Case Glossary ( A list of all use cases for the system describing what this system is being used for ) /Table ( templates to be used)
Task 5: UseCase diagrams/ UseCase narratives
a. Use Case Model Diagram for the whole system including defined system boundaries.
AT least three boundaries are expected (sample of possible boundaries: Entry, payments, leaving, etc.)
b. Use case narratives for major use cases within each chosen boundaries. ( at least two for each boundaries , minimum 6 narratives
Task 6: Produce state transition diagram for three selected objects within the designed system
Select three most complicated objects within your system design. Explain the complexity of each object and draw three state transition diagram for selected objects. State transition diagram is to identify all state of an object (Class) by applying given events which will change the state of an object.
Task 7: Identifying software objects within Use Cases/ creating communication diagrams
a. Identify and sketch “Interface”, “controller “and “entity” objects for all major use cases you identified in task 4 (this can be done in Ms World, as EA does not support this action directly, you draw the refined version of this as communication diagram).
You need to explain briefly how did you decide to draw each diagram and what was your logic behind decisions you made. (Minimum 6 major use cases)
b. Transfer all drawn use case objects /relations above to proper communication diagrams and identify /add all relevant messages between each objects (all messages must be named, numbered and include directions between each object).
Produce set of sequence diagram for all Uses cases that you produced narrative for in question 2, each diagram should have at least a paragraph explaining the sequence diagram you made ( Chosen UseCases for drawing sequence diagram can be the same as the one were chosen for drawing communication diagram) 12 marks
Hint1: (you can get help from the narrative you produced in task 2)
Hint 2: (Sequence diagram is the transformation of communication diagram, having sequence timing in mind)
Task 9: Produce an analysis/design final class diagram
Produce full analysis/design class diagram for the part of systems that communication and sequence diagram was produced (Minimum 6 Diagrams).In these diagrams you should identify all the characteristics of an object class that will make it ready for a programmer to use this class diagram and enable them to code the system. They should include all correct connections based on prior analysis, class attributes and methods and to be indicated which one is public, private … and etc.
Buy Comp6209 System Analysis And Assessment Answers Online
Talk to our expert to get the help with Comp6209 System Analysis And Assessment Answers to complete your assessment on time and boost your grades now
The main aim/motive of the management assignment help services is to get connect with a greater number of students, and effectively help, and support them in getting completing their assignments the students also get find this a wonderful opportunity where they could effectively learn more about their topics, as the experts also have the best team members with them in which all the members effectively support each other to get complete their diploma assignments. They complete the assessments of the students in an appropriate manner and deliver them back to the students before the due date of the assignment so that the students could timely submit this, and can score higher marks. The experts of the assignment help services at urgenthomework.com are so much skilled, capable, talented, and experienced in their field of programming homework help writing assignments, so, for this, they can effectively write the best economics assignment help services.
Get Online Support for Comp6209 System Analysis And Assessment Answer Assignment Help Online
Resources
- 24 x 7 Availability.
- Trained and Certified Experts.
- Deadline Guaranteed.
- Plagiarism Free.
- Privacy Guaranteed.
- Free download.
- Online help for all project.
- Homework Help Services